Output 975690b4559f98e0a1d3ab766e77002e7cf854501de77a30e6a7ac1c7e94d3e9:0

value
25677281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224af221deb13f91a93e1d03ecc91cb708bb353a OP_EQUAL
address
34pLgPmz762KEEd8tMBP8fsbWVFGcATa6D
transaction
975690b4559f98e0a1d3ab766e77002e7cf854501de77a30e6a7ac1c7e94d3e9
spent
true